How does Fitbit make money?

Fitbit makes money primarily through the sale of wearable devices like fitness trackers and smartwatches. Additionally, it generates revenue from subscription services for health and fitness data analysis and partnerships with health organizations. As a company, it also earns from licensing its technology and data analytics solutions.

Purpose

To perform part-time research intervention duties at the School of Nursing, under the supervision of Dr. Wonshik Chee. This study is to investigate the promotion of a web-app based physical activity program.

Responsibilities

  • Weekly Interventions: Conduct weekly interventions with participants via chat in Simplified Korean or English.

  • Procedural Tasks: Maintain a research diary, manage communications for participant payments and Fitbit distribution, and coordinate with the Principal Investigator (PI), Coordinator, and peer interventionists.

  • Recruitment Activities: Engage in recruitment activities to support the study.

Required Qualifications

  • Licensure: Current Registered Nurse (RN) license within the U.S.

  • Language Proficiency: Fluency in Korean and English (both spoken and written)

  • Communication Skills: Strong interpersonal and communication skills

  • Technical Skills: Basic proficiency in Zoom, MS Office, Microsoft Teams, etc.

  • Flexibility: Ability to work according to participants' schedules in different time zones.
